In September 2018, we opened our doors to the 180 founding students of our co-education 11-18 yr comprehensive school. Our new school is firmly set to be a beacon of excellence for secondary education in the Royal Borough of Greenwich. We are driven by the belief that every learner is entitled to an enriching, varied and personalised education; delivered through a broad and balanced curriculum that provides challenge, irrespective of need, starting point or background. Our mission is to ensure all our students develop into powerful citizens of the digital future on both a national and global scale.

Our strong learning community works together and shares the value of collaboration; every member of our academy family works together to achieve success, cultivating a strong sense of belonging. Our belief in ‘human-scale’ education, delivered through a schools-within-schools model, ensures every one of our students is known and valued. Strong pastoral care is at the heart of our academy and we place great importance on building strong partnerships with parents and carers.

Working in a brand new school is a unique opportunity. A flexible approach with a can-do ethos is required, as is drive, grit and boundless enthusiasm. A sense of humour is essential! We have a fantastic opportunity and are seeking to appoint a Teacher of Music and Drama who can deliver high-quality learning opportunities for our students across these curriculum areas. Applications are welcome from experienced and newly qualified teachers, or those who do not currently have Qualified Teacher Status but have plenty of experience in this remit. The role is offered on a part-time basis, equivalent to 3 days per week - ideal for candidates with other commitments.

This position is offered on a fixed term basis in the first instance until August 2019, with every intention to become permanent in due course.
